Understanding the BC Human Rights Tribunal Complaint Process
The BC Human Rights Tribunal provides a formal process for individuals to file complaints regarding discrimination. This process is essential for those seeking to address grievances related to human rights violations in British Columbia. A complaint can be filed by an individual on their own behalf or on behalf of another person who has experienced discrimination. The tribunal aims to ensure that all individuals are treated fairly and equitably, regardless of their background or circumstances.
Steps to Complete the BC Human Rights Complaint Form
Completing the BC human rights complaint form involves several key steps. First, gather all relevant information regarding the incident, including dates, locations, and the nature of the discrimination. Next, fill out the complaint form, ensuring that all sections are completed accurately. It is important to clearly describe the discriminatory actions and how they have affected you or the person you are representing. After completing the form, review it for accuracy before submission.
Required Documents for Filing a Complaint
When filing a complaint with the BC Human Rights Tribunal, certain documents may be required to support your case. These documents can include any evidence of discrimination, such as emails, photographs, or witness statements. Additionally, you may need to provide identification and any relevant correspondence related to the incident. Ensuring that you have all necessary documentation can strengthen your complaint and facilitate the tribunal's review process.
Form Submission Methods
The BC human rights complaint form can be submitted through various methods. Individuals have the option to file their complaints online, which is often the most efficient method. Alternatively, complaints can be submitted by mail or in person at designated tribunal offices. Each submission method has specific requirements, so it is important to follow the guidelines provided by the tribunal to ensure that your complaint is processed without delay.
Eligibility Criteria for Filing a Complaint
To file a complaint with the BC Human Rights Tribunal, certain eligibility criteria must be met. The individual filing the complaint must be a resident of British Columbia and must have experienced discrimination in a context covered by the Human Rights Code. This includes areas such as employment, housing, and services. Understanding these criteria is crucial to determine whether your situation qualifies for a complaint.
Filing Deadlines and Important Dates
Filing deadlines are critical in the complaint process. Generally, complaints must be filed within one year of the incident of discrimination. It is important to keep track of these timelines to ensure that your complaint is submitted on time. Missing a deadline may result in the dismissal of your case, so being aware of important dates is essential for a successful filing.

How long does the BC Human Rights Tribunal take to process?
It usually takes about one to two months for the Tribunal to decide if can deal with a complaint. If the parties agree to mediate, this usually takes about four months from the time the Tribunal notifies the respondent about the complaint.

What does the BC Human Rights Tribunal do?
British Columbia Human Rights Tribunal The BC Human Rights Tribunal is responsible for accepting, screening, mediating, and adjudicating human rights complaints.

What is the B.C. policy on discrimination?
We all have the right to be free from discrimination in employment and housing, when accessing services and in union membership and in publications. Under B.C.'s Human Rights Code, we are protected from discrimination on the basis of a number of grounds such as gender identity, race and disability.

What is the B.C. employment Standards Act Human Rights Code?
The B.C. Human Rights Code defines the basic rights of everyone in B.C. It prohibits discrimination in hiring and harassment on the job and requires equal pay regardless of gender.
